Why are Virtual Data Rooms used?
Virtual Data Room (VDR) is an online warehouse used to store and distribute documents. In other words virtual data room (or deal room) is an online repository of electronic information. It is a highly secured web-based platform used for storing and distributing confidential information about companies. It provides authorized users access to highly sensitive information of company over internet in a secured environment.
Virtual data rooms have replaced the traditional physical data rooms for reasons of efficiency, security, and cost. With a VDR, documents and information reach the regulators and investors in a more efficient and timely manner. A virtual data room is set up in the form of an extranet to which the bidders, potential buyers and their advisors are given access through internet.
Usually a VDR is used to facilitate due diligence process during mergers and acquisitions (M&A). In the process of M&A, virtual data room is set up to provide financial and non-financial information about company. The virtual data room allows the interested parties to view information about the company in a controlled environment.

How virtual data rooms are used by different organizations?
Having discussed what virtual data rooms are, now we will discuss how various forms of organization can use VDRs and benefit from them.
Investment Banks and Investment companies
With the help of virtual data rooms, the investment banks, private banks, merchant banks and companies can manage their multiple clients simultaneously. It also allows them to manage each transaction of their client. VDR enables the clients of the investing bank to establish separate, secure data rooms for their individual company.
Venture Capital
Similar to investment banks, the venture capital organizations can use VDR to manage their multiple clients and transactions. The portfolio companies of venture capital can use VDR to raise capital, to conduct mergers and acquisitions, and to sell.
Public companies
The regulating authorities are increasingly requiring the public companies to enhance transparency of their transactions and dealings. Therefore, it is imperative for them to maintain well organized detailed information and have it readily available for the investors, bankers, accountants, auditors, and anybody who has the right to access the company information. Virtual data rooms can help public companies to maintain such information at a minimum cost and with greater efficiency.
Private companies
A VDR allows private companies to maintain its records and documents in an organized manner on a remote secure location. The managerial staff and executives can view the information from the convenience of their home or any location.
Accounting Firms
Virtual data rooms will enable accountants to establish data rooms for each of their clients and store all of their accounting and financial documents online. This will reduce the travelling, storing and shipping costs. It will help increase collaboration because multiple accountants, managers, and lawyers will be able to access the information of each client simultaneously.
Law Firms
The law firms can use virtual data rooms to store all of the relevant legal documents of their each client. This will enable multiple lawyers to access the information remotely and simultaneously.
Private Equity
Private equity firms can coordinate confidential documents for investigation by the bidders or bidding teams at all phases of private equity fund management.
